Climate Change Fueling Europe’s Ferocious Heat Wave, Scientists Find

Scientists have found that climate change is fueling Europe's severe heat wave, determining that such high temperatures across the continent would not have been possible without global warming. The analysis suggests a direct link between rising global temperatures and the extreme heat wave affecting much of Europe. Global warming has increased the likelihood and severity of heat waves, making extreme weather events like this more probable. Europe's heat wave is a stark example of the real-world impacts of climate change.
